The two hundred and ninety-one day (291) day of the heroic resistance of the Ukrainian people to a russian military large-scale invasion continues.

Northern oblasts

Kyiv

Mayor of Barcelona Ada Colau came to Kyiv and met with Vitaliy Klitschko. She assured that she would do everything possible to ensure that the partners continue to help Ukraine and Kyiv.

Starting today, new stabilization shutdown schedules are in effect in Kyiv. They have been developed taking into account the difficult situation in the energy system, which resulted from the recent terrorist attacks.

Kyiv Oblast

Mine clearance activities continue in the Kyiv Oblast. During the last day, explosive devices were found in Bucha and the village of Kopyliv, Bucha Raion. 15 items of unexploded ordnance were neutralized. 

12 apartment buildings are currently being restored in Borodianka. Among them are the houses on Kyivska Street, where the windows and doors are being replaced, and the roofs are being repaired.

Another house damaged during the war is being dismantled in Irpin.

Zhytomyr Oblast

At St. Michael’s Cathedral In Zhytomyr they said goodbye to two defenders of Ukraine, Denys Humyniuk and Volodymyr Melekhov. Both volunteered to join the Defense Forces in the early days of the full-scale war. They were killed in battles on the eastern borders of the country. Eternal glory and blessed memory to our Heroes.

Estonia has sent 11 more buses with generators and power equipment to Ukraine. All this was delivered to Zhytomyr, Kharkiv, Bucha, and Poltava.

Sumy Oblast

During December 9, the russian military carried out 48 strikes on the border areas of the Sumy Oblast. The russian army shelled the Shalyhyne and Yunakivka communities.

Yesterday, around 9:00 p.m., the russian army launched a missile attack on the Velyka Pysarivka community. 20 private houses, an apartment building, a fire station, an executive office, a bank branch, 5 shops, and several cars were damaged.

Eastern oblasts

Kharkiv Oblast

The enemy continues shelling the settlements of the Kharkiv Oblast, which are located not far from the line of contact and the border with the russian federation.

During the day, the areas of Kupiansk, Zolochiv, Dvorichna, Strilecha, Berestove and other localities were shelled with artillery and mortars.

A fire broke out in warehouses in Kupiansk as a result of shelling. An administrative building in Zolochiv and an infrastructure facility in the Zolochiv community were damaged.

Mine clearance works continue. Over the last day, 122 explosive items were defused.

Donetsk Oblast

Russia continues to detain 150 Ukrainians in the penal colony in the village of Olenivka in the Donetsk Oblast. Among them are military personnel and civilians.

On December 9, it became known about 4 civilians of the Donetsk Oblast wounded by the russian military: two people in Bakhmut, one in Avdiivka, and one in Kostiantynivka.

Since February 24, the russians have killed 1,251 civilians of the Donetsk region, and wounded another 2,715. The number of victims in Mariupol and Volnovakha is currently unknown.

Pokrovsk and Pokrovsk Raion

Over the past day, the occupiers opened fire on the settlements in the east of the Pokrovsk Raion: the towns of Avdiivka, Hirnyk, Kurakhove, and the village of Kamianka. The enemy fired from aircraft, Grad multiple rocket launchers, artillery, mortars, and tanks. No information on casualties and damage has been received.

Avdiivka withstood the biggest number of strikes – eleven.

The situation in the Pokrovsk community is under the control of the Military Administration.

Over the past day, employees of the State Emergency Service were involved in the elimination of one fire. No casualties have been reported.

Another Hero of the Pokrovsk community was killed. 41-year-old Vitaliy Bartashevych defended the Ukrainian land from the russian aggressor from the first days of the war. His life ended during a fire clash with the invaders. The defender of Pokrovsk is survived by his wife and two minor children.

Bakhmut and Bakhmut Raion

In the Bakhmut sector, more than 20 settlements came under fire of the russian occupiers. Among them are Verkhniokamianske, Berestove, Bilohorivka, Vesele, Yakovlivka, Soledar, Bakhmutske, Bakhmut, Opytne, Klishchiivka, Andriivka, Bila Hora, Kurdiumivka, Ozarianivka, Dyliivka, Druzhba, and Zalizne in the Donetsk Oblast.

In the Horlivka sector, 2 people were wounded in Bakhmut. A house and a shop were damaged in the town. Sporadic shelling was recorded on the outskirts of the Toretsk and Soledar communities.

Kramatorsk and Kramatorsk Raion

During the day, explosions were heard, which are typical for air defense operations. The destruction was not officially reported.

Constant russian missile strikes on the energy infrastructure of Ukraine, and, as a result, emergency shutdowns and voltage drops, caused the shutdown of the TTP pumping stations. This also causes hydraulic shocks in the heating networks, which leads to the destruction of the equipment.

So far, the Kramatorsk Thermal Power Plant has suffered from emergency power outages three times. After the last shelling by the russian federation on Monday and a long emergency power outage, the coolant was drained from buildings with overhead heating. Employees of “Kramatorskteploenergo” are working to eliminate surges, after which the station will be restarted.  

The “Amazing Fish” aquarium in Kramatorsk lost four fish due to a blackout and, to prevent this from happening again, is raising money for a generator. Since the beginning of the full-scale war, hundreds of fish, whose owners were evacuated from Kramatorsk and could not take their pets with them, have found shelter in the aquarium. Currently, there are about half a thousand large fish in the “Amazing Fishes”. They live in six aquariums with a volume of two tons each. Due to problems with the energy infrastructure of the country, they were in danger of death.

Luhansk Oblast

“Ukrposhta” [Ukrainian post operator] is ready to pay out pensions in the liberated settlements. Mobile communication has also been established there. Food is delivered to people, medical assistance is provided, and hygiene products are brought in.

The russians continue the forced integration of all spheres of life. In particular, entrepreneurs of the fake “Luhansk people’s republic” who do not register in the unified state register of the russian federation during December will not be able to use support for small and medium-sized enterprises. Such an incentive is provided only after registration. Accordingly, it is necessary to have an updated package of russian-style documents.

Southern Oblasts

Zaporizhzhia Oblast 

Over the past 24 hours, on December 9, the russian military shelled civilian infrastructure in the area of 16 settlements in the Zaporizhzhia Oblast. The police received 32 reports about the destruction of residential buildings.

On the night of December 9, the russian military attacked one of the communities in Zaporizhzhia Raion with S-300 missiles. As a result, the road between the two villages was destroyed.

The russian soldiers beat and took the head of the Department of Social Programs of the Zaporizhzhia NPP and his deputy to an unknown destination. The shift chief of the station, who is directly responsible for nuclear and radiation safety, was also detained.

Kherson Oblast 

According to the Kherson City Military Administration, as of December 9, 22 infrastructure objects, 26 educational institutions and 274 houses were damaged in the oblast center.

As a result of shelling by russian troops in Kherson and the oblast on December 9, two people were killed and eight were injured.

Russian occupiers shelled the maternity ward of the hospital in Kherson, the building was damaged. There were no injured or dead.

In the Kherson Oblast, pyrotechnicians have already demined 800 hectares of territory, including 200 kilometers of roads and 20 kilometers of power lines.

In the Kherson Oblast, the prosecutor’s office is investigating the fact of ecocide. In March, most of the 4 million chickens died in Chornobaivka due to power outages caused by russian shelling at the poultry factory. According to law enforcement officials, bacterial contamination of a large area could have occurred.

The municipal utility company “Kherson Vodokanal” received 10 generators. Powerful ones will be used on artesian wells, small ones – for emergency water supply and drainage teams.

The library “Lviv Polytechnic” transferred more than 300 books to the libraries of Kherson. The transfer took place as part of the “Ukrainian book for the Ukrainian Kherson Oblast” support campaign.

Odesa Oblast

At night, the enemy attacked the south of the country with kamikaze drones. Continuing man-made terror targeted energy infrastructure facilities in the Odesa Oblast, causing significant destruction and leaving thousands of consumers without electricity. There is no information about the victims. The work of rescue and recovery services continues.

According to DTEK “Odesa Electric Grids”, currently the situation with electricity supply in the oblast and the city of Odesa is difficult. Due to the scale of the destruction of the energy infrastructure in Odesa, all consumers, except for critical infrastructure, have been disconnected from electricity. The city has water supply and drainage. All municipal utilities work 24 hours a day. Eleven district boiler houses and most of the small ones are working. Hospitals and maternity homes are provided with electricity and water. All “Points of Invincibility” are open.
